Summary Vermont, 1950. There's a place for the girls whom no one wants. It's called Idlewild Hall. Four roommates bond over their whispered fears, their budding friendship blossoming - until one of them mysteriously disappears. Vermont, 2014. When journalist Fiona Sheridan discovers that Idlewild Hall is being restored by an anonymous benefactor, she decides to write a story about it. But a shocking discovery during the renovations will link the loss of her sister to secrets that were meant to stay hidden in the past - and a voice that won't be silenced. Residence: Toronto, ON.
